Output 85a458538c72ce8eb0043069566d2af54a9794dfd1b7ca0a33fd3c52770c4a7c:1

value
288850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3817e4b40f54578e7dd3eb995fd29b97a1ba1bd OP_EQUAL
address
3J4A1EeWE8Za3Xiqmpn5jRv2oRnZd4qzmS
transaction
85a458538c72ce8eb0043069566d2af54a9794dfd1b7ca0a33fd3c52770c4a7c
spent
true